How Can You Customize Your Xbox Controller Experience?
You can customize your Xbox controller experience through several methods that enhance performance and personalization.
- Adjustable Thumbstick Tension: Many advanced Xbox controllers allow users to adjust the tension of the thumbsticks, providing a tailored feel that suits different play styles. This feature can help improve precision in aiming or speed in movement, making it ideal for various gaming genres.
- Custom Button Mapping: The Xbox accessories app offers the ability to remap buttons on your controller, allowing you to assign actions that best fit your gameplay preferences. This customization can streamline your controls, making it easier to perform complex maneuvers and improve response times during competitive play.
- Interchangeable Thumbstick and D-pad Styles: Some high-end controllers come with interchangeable thumbsticks and D-pads, allowing players to switch between different shapes and sizes. This not only enhances comfort but also helps in achieving better grip and control, depending on the game being played.
- Vibration Feedback Settings: Adjusting the vibration feedback can greatly impact gameplay, as players can increase or decrease the intensity of vibrations based on personal preference. This can help in providing subtle cues during gameplay or minimizing distractions during intense gaming sessions.
- Customizable Lighting Effects: Some Xbox controllers feature customizable LED lighting that can be adjusted for brightness and color. This adds a personal touch to your gaming setup and can also serve as a visual indicator for in-game events or notifications.
- Profile Creation: Users can create multiple profiles for different games or gaming scenarios, each with its own settings for button mapping, thumbstick sensitivity, and vibration feedback. This allows for quick switching between setups, ensuring that you’re always ready for whatever game you’re playing.
What Are the Common Issues and Solutions for Xbox Controllers?
Common issues with Xbox controllers often arise from connectivity, performance, or physical damage, but there are effective solutions for each.
- Connectivity Problems: Xbox controllers may occasionally struggle to connect to the console or PC, often due to interference or low battery levels.
- Drifting Analog Sticks: Analog stick drift occurs when the controller registers movement even when the stick is at rest, which can affect gameplay significantly.
- Button Malfunction: Buttons may become unresponsive or sticky over time, often due to dirt buildup or wear and tear.
- Battery Issues: Controllers powered by batteries can experience short battery life or failure to charge, which can interrupt gaming sessions.
- Firmware Updates: Outdated firmware may cause compatibility issues or performance problems, requiring regular updates to function optimally.
Connectivity problems are often resolved by ensuring that the controller is within range of the console or PC and that there are no electronic devices causing interference. Replacing batteries or charging the controller can also help, as low power can lead to connectivity issues.
Drifting analog sticks can be addressed by cleaning around the base of the stick with compressed air or using specialized cleaning solutions. In some cases, replacing the internal components or recalibrating the controller through the Xbox settings may be necessary.
For button malfunctions, users should clean the exterior and interior of the controller. If the problem persists, disassembly may be needed to fix or replace faulty components.
Battery issues can be mitigated by using high-quality rechargeable batteries or the Xbox Play and Charge Kit, which provides a more reliable power source. Regularly checking battery levels can prevent unexpected shutdowns during gameplay.
To keep controllers functioning smoothly, it’s advisable to check for firmware updates regularly through the Xbox accessories app, as manufacturers often release updates to fix bugs and enhance performance.
